Broad Band Ethernet Problem

I just reformatted my HD and installed a fresh copy of XP pro on my machine. Now I can't get it to connect to my DSL. I check the hardware profile and the Ethernet adapter is seen. When I plug the cable in, the led turns on for the plug. I tried to run the software cd from Verizon but it is not able to connect to there site. Any ideas would be greatly appreciated.
